Understanding Your Pigmentation: The First Step to a Targeted Solution
Before you can choose the right tool, you need to understand the problem you’re trying to solve. Not all pigmentation is created equal, and the type you have will dictate the most effective course of action.
Melasma vs. Sunspots vs. PIH
- Melasma: Often triggered by hormonal changes (e.g., pregnancy, birth control pills) and sun exposure, melasma appears as large, blotchy patches, typically on the cheeks, forehead, chin, and upper lip. It’s a notoriously stubborn form of pigmentation, requiring a gentle, consistent, and multi-faceted approach.
-
Sunspots (Lentigines): These are small, well-defined dark spots that result from chronic sun exposure. They are a classic sign of photodamage and are generally easier to treat than melasma.
-
Post-Inflammatory Hyperpigmentation (PIH): This occurs after the skin has experienced some form of trauma or inflammation, such as acne breakouts, cuts, or bug bites. The skin produces excess melanin in response to the injury, leaving a flat, discolored patch that fades over time.

The Three Pillars of Chemical Exfoliation: AHAs, BHAs, and PHAs
The world of chemical exfoliants is largely defined by these three acronyms. Understanding their unique properties is the cornerstone of making an informed decision.
Alpha-Hydroxy Acids (AHAs): The Surface-Level Brighteners
AHAs are water-soluble acids derived from natural sources like fruit and milk. They work on the surface of the skin, dissolving the “glue” that holds dead skin cells together. Because they are water-soluble, they don’t penetrate deep into pores. This makes them ideal for treating surface-level concerns like sun damage and a dull, uneven texture.
Key AHAs to Consider:
- Glycolic Acid: The smallest AHA molecule, glycolic acid is a powerhouse. Its tiny size allows it to penetrate the skin effectively, making it a gold standard for exfoliation.
- Best for: Widespread sun damage, overall skin dullness, and improving the appearance of fine lines.
-
How to Choose: Start with a lower concentration (5-8%) if you have sensitive skin. Look for products with a pH between 3.0 and 4.0 for optimal efficacy.
-
Concrete Example: If you have numerous small sunspots on your cheeks, a glycolic acid toner used 2-3 times a week could significantly improve their appearance over several months.
-
Lactic Acid: A larger molecule than glycolic acid, lactic acid is gentler and more hydrating. It’s a great choice for those with dry or sensitive skin who still want the benefits of an AHA.
- Best for: Mild sun damage, PIH, and improving skin texture without causing excessive dryness.
-
How to Choose: A lactic acid serum in a concentration of 5-10% is an excellent starting point.
-
Concrete Example: If you have combination skin with a few PIH marks from old breakouts and a tendency towards dryness, a 10% lactic acid serum can gently fade the marks while providing a dose of hydration.
-
Mandelic Acid: The largest AHA molecule, mandelic acid is derived from bitter almonds. Its large size means it penetrates the skin slowly, making it one of the gentlest AHAs. It also has antibacterial properties, which is a bonus for those with acne-prone skin and PIH.
- Best for: Melasma, sensitive skin, and PIH in darker skin tones (as it’s less likely to cause irritation that could lead to new dark spots).
-
How to Choose: Look for a serum or toner with a concentration of 5-10%.
-
Concrete Example: If you have melasma that is easily triggered by irritation, a 10% mandelic acid serum applied a few nights a week could be a safe and effective way to manage your condition.
Beta-Hydroxy Acids (BHAs): The Pore-Deep Purifiers
BHAs are oil-soluble acids, with salicylic acid being the most common example. This unique property allows them to penetrate into the pores, where they can dissolve excess sebum and dead skin cells. This makes them the ultimate choice for acne-prone skin and the PIH that often accompanies it.
- Salicylic Acid: Derived from willow bark, salicylic acid is a keratolytic agent, meaning it helps to shed the outer layer of the skin. Its oil-solubility is what sets it apart.
- Best for: Post-inflammatory hyperpigmentation (PIH), especially from acne, and blackheads.
-
How to Choose: A leave-on product like a toner or serum in a 1-2% concentration is ideal. Spot treatments can be used at higher concentrations.
-
Concrete Example: If you have a cluster of dark marks on your chin from a recent breakout, using a 2% salicylic acid toner every other night will not only help fade the existing marks but also prevent new ones by keeping your pores clear.
Poly-Hydroxy Acids (PHAs): The Gentle Giants
PHAs are a newer generation of chemical exfoliants, including gluconolactone and lactobionic acid. Like AHAs, they are water-soluble, but their molecular structure is much larger. This means they cannot penetrate the skin as deeply, making them the gentlest option available. They also act as humectants, drawing moisture into the skin.
- Best for: Extremely sensitive skin, rosacea-prone skin, and those who find AHAs too irritating. They are a great entry point into chemical exfoliation for people with a history of irritation.
-
How to Choose: Look for serums, toners, or cleansers containing gluconolactone or lactobionic acid.
-
Concrete Example: If you have sensitive skin with mild sun damage and want to improve your skin’s overall tone without risking irritation, a toner with gluconolactone used daily could provide gradual but noticeable results.
Crafting Your Action Plan: A Step-by-Step Approach
Choosing the right exfoliant is only half the battle. Knowing how to incorporate it into your routine for maximum benefit and minimal irritation is the key to success.
Step 1: Start Low and Go Slow
This is the most critical rule of chemical exfoliation. Introducing a new active ingredient too quickly is the fastest way to damage your skin barrier, leading to irritation, inflammation, and, ironically, more PIH.
- Actionable Insight: Begin by using your chosen exfoliant just once a week. Observe how your skin reacts. If there’s no redness, stinging, or peeling after a week or two, you can gradually increase to 2-3 times per week. Never use a new active product every day from the get-go.
-
Concrete Example: You’ve decided on a 10% glycolic acid toner. For the first two weeks, use it only on Sunday nights. If your skin is fine, increase to Sunday and Wednesday nights. This slow progression allows your skin to build tolerance without a negative reaction.
Step 2: The Importance of Sun Protection
Chemical exfoliants can make your skin more sensitive to the sun. This is non-negotiable. Without consistent, daily sun protection, any progress you make in fading pigmentation will be undone and may even worsen.
- Actionable Insight: Always, without exception, apply a broad-spectrum sunscreen with an SPF of 30 or higher every morning, rain or shine. Reapply every two hours if you’re outdoors.
-
Concrete Example: On the days you use your glycolic acid toner, apply your sunscreen diligently in the morning. Even on days you don’t use it, continued sun protection is vital to prevent new sunspots and maintain the results you’ve achieved.
Step 3: Pairing with Other Actives (The Do’s and Don’ts)
Combining chemical exfoliants with other powerful actives can supercharge your routine, but it requires careful planning to avoid irritation.
- The “Do’s”:
- Exfoliant + Niacinamide: Niacinamide (Vitamin B3) is a powerful ingredient that helps strengthen the skin barrier, calm inflammation, and even inhibit the transfer of melanin to the skin’s surface. It pairs beautifully with all chemical exfoliants.
- Concrete Example: Use a 10% lactic acid serum at night, followed by a niacinamide serum. The niacinamide will help soothe the skin and further assist in fading pigmentation.
- Exfoliant + Vitamin C: Vitamin C is a potent antioxidant that brightens the skin and protects against environmental damage. While you shouldn’t use them at the same time (e.g., in the same application step), you can incorporate them into your routine.
- Concrete Example: Use your glycolic acid toner on Monday and Wednesday nights. Use a Vitamin C serum every morning. This separation prevents a potential pH imbalance and irritation.
- Exfoliant + Retinoids (Tretinoin, Retinol): This is a powerful combination for advanced users, but it requires extreme caution. Both are potent and can cause irritation.
- Concrete Example: Instead of using them on the same night, alternate nights. Use your mandelic acid serum on Monday and Thursday, and your retinol on Tuesday and Friday. This provides the benefits of both without overwhelming your skin.

- The “Don’ts”:
- Don’t Layer AHAs/BHAs/PHAs: Using a glycolic acid toner and a salicylic acid serum on the same night is a recipe for irritation and a damaged skin barrier. Choose one for your targeted concern.
-
Don’t Use Physical Scrubs: While you’re chemically exfoliating, avoid harsh physical scrubs with rough particles. This is a one-way ticket to over-exfoliation and a compromised skin barrier.
Concrete Solutions for Specific Pigmentation Concerns
Now, let’s tie everything together with practical, real-world examples for different skin types and pigmentation issues.
Case Study 1: Widespread Sun Damage and Dullness (Normal/Combination Skin)
- Problem: Numerous small sunspots, uneven skin tone, and a lack of radiance.
-
Primary Exfoliant: Glycolic Acid (5-8% concentration)
-
Why: Glycolic acid’s small size allows it to effectively target surface-level sun damage and improve overall skin texture.
-
Sample Routine:
- PM (Monday, Wednesday): Cleanse > 5-8% Glycolic Acid Toner (wait 10 minutes) > Hydrating Serum > Moisturizer.
-
AM (Daily): Cleanse > Antioxidant Serum (e.g., Vitamin C) > SPF 30+.
-
Expected Outcome: After 4-6 weeks of consistent use, a noticeable improvement in skin brightness and a gradual fading of sunspots.
Case Study 2: Post-Inflammatory Hyperpigmentation (PIH) from Acne (Oily/Acne-Prone Skin)
-
Problem: Dark marks left behind from recent breakouts on the cheeks and chin.
-
Primary Exfoliant: Salicylic Acid (2% concentration)
-
Why: Salicylic acid’s oil-solubility allows it to penetrate deep into the pores, addressing the root cause of the acne while also helping to fade the resulting PIH.
-
Sample Routine:
- PM (Tuesday, Friday): Cleanse > 2% Salicylic Acid Serum > Niacinamide Serum > Lightweight Moisturizer.
-
AM (Daily): Cleanse > SPF 30+.
-
Expected Outcome: Within a few weeks, a reduction in new breakouts and a faster fading of existing dark marks.
Case Study 3: Melasma and Sensitive Skin (Dry/Sensitive Skin)
-
Problem: Large, patchy areas of pigmentation on the cheeks and forehead, with a tendency toward redness and irritation.
-
Primary Exfoliant: Mandelic Acid (5-10% concentration)
-
Why: Mandelic acid’s large molecule size and gentle nature make it the safest choice for delicate skin types prone to irritation, which can worsen melasma.
-
Sample Routine:
- PM (Sunday, Thursday): Cleanse > 10% Mandelic Acid Serum > Hydrating Toner > Calming Moisturizer.
-
AM (Daily): Cleanse > Hydrating Serum > SPF 50+.
-
Expected Outcome: Gradual, gentle fading of melasma patches without the risk of irritation-induced darkening. This approach requires patience and consistency.
Troubleshooting Common Issues
-
Issue: “My skin is stinging and red!”
- Diagnosis: This is a sign of a compromised skin barrier. You’re likely over-exfoliating or using a product that’s too strong.
-
Action: Stop all exfoliating products immediately. Focus on a simple, gentle routine with a barrier-repairing moisturizer (look for ceramides and niacinamide). Once your skin has fully recovered (no more redness or stinging), reintroduce the exfoliant at a much lower frequency.
-
Issue: “I’m not seeing any results.”
- Diagnosis: This could be due to several factors: the concentration is too low, you’re not using it consistently, or you’re not using adequate sun protection.
-
Action: First, be patient. Fading pigmentation takes time (often 6-12 weeks). Double-check your sunscreen application. If your skin has built tolerance, you may consider a slightly higher concentration, but only after a few months of no progress.
-
Issue: “I’m getting new breakouts after starting a new product.”
- Diagnosis: This is a common phenomenon known as “purging.” When you start using a new exfoliant, it can speed up the skin’s cell turnover, bringing existing micro-comedones (clogged pores) to the surface faster.
-
Action: This is normal and a sign the product is working. It should subside within a few weeks. If the breakouts are new and appear in areas you don’t normally breakout, it’s likely a negative reaction. Stop use immediately.
